JOB SUMMARY:
Manages re-engineering efforts associated with safety compliance, improved ride reliability and enhanced show quality for all of the high technology ride and show attractions at Universal Orlando Resort. The manager will also assist the Director in maintaining cost controls within Engineering's assigned budget. Work with the attractions to identify, define, and prioritize capital issues to realize optimum cost-of-ownership of Universal Orlando's assets in Rides and Shows.
M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ES:
SCOPE:
Responsible for the operation of the UO Sustaining Engineering Department. Manage and oversee the activities of the Sustaining Engineers and provide direction for the engineering support to the UO Tech Services Department. Interact with the UO Ride/Show Maintenance Department and the UO Controls Engineering Department to ensure that technical support and training requirements are met in order to improve the reliability and operation of ride and show control systems. Provide immediate support to any UO emergency.
